Roots Makes It to the InsurTech 100 List for 2025, Celebrating AI Innovation

Roots: Innovating Insurance with Agentic AI



In a major achievement, Roots, a groundbreaking technology company, has been named one of the most innovative companies in the insurance technology sector by earning a spot on the InsurTech 100 list for 2025. This prestigious recognition reflects the company's substantial contributions toward revolutionizing ordinary insurance operations through advanced AI technologies. The crowning jewel of Roots' innovation is its proprietary AI model, InsurGPT™, hailed as the world's first generative AI model explicitly designed for the insurance industry.

Tackling Critical Challenges in Insurance


The insurance industry has been mired in inefficiencies related to unstructured data, leading to staggering annual losses estimated at over $100 billion in claims processing alone. In response to these challenges, Roots has developed a state-of-the-art agentic AI platform aimed at streamlining processes and enhancing precision in insurance operations. By deploying its cutting-edge InsurGPT model, Roots empowers insurance companies to significantly improve their operational capabilities, allowing them to achieve straight-through processing rates of up to 80%. This high level of accuracy translates to considerable returns on investment, as insurers are able to drastically cut down on unnecessary costs associated with poorly organized data.

Rapid Growth and Market Traction


The company has shown impressive growth metrics, boasting a remarkable 100% increase in revenue for the year 2024. Its success can be attributed to an extensive list of high-profile clients, including three of the top five property and casualty (PC) carriers, three of the top ten U.S. brokers, and three of the top twenty third-party administrators (TPAs). This level of client adoption and satisfaction is a powerful indicator of Roots’ leading position in the marketplace.

Industry Recognition and Future Implementations


The InsurTech 100 list is annually curated by FinTech Global, which evaluates over 2,100 companies before selecting those that demonstrate revolutionary potential in insurance technology. According to Mariyan Dimitrov, Director of Research and Product Development at FinTech Global, Roots stands out with its strong industry focus and innovative AI offerings that are crucial in transforming unstructured data into insightful, strategic decision-making tools for insurers worldwide.
